Notice Sending Delegate to a Local Anti-Masonic Convention, 1832 August 20
This notice from Jonathan Slade (Secretary, Troy [Fall River], MA) certifies the selection of Reverend Levi Chase (a former Mason) as a delegate to the Bristol County Anti-Masonic Party's political convention held on August 23, 1832, at Taunton, Massachusetts. Written while at Fall River, Massachusetts, and dated August 20, 1832.
Letter to John Tanner from S. D. Spear, 1845 September 16
S. D. Spear, the Secretary of Frontier Lodge, No. 167 (Rouse's Point, New York), requests back issues of The Gavel, an Odd Fellows periodical, and highlights the growth of his lodge. Addressed to John Tanner and dated September 16, 1845. Tanner was co-editor and publisher of The Gavel: A Monthly Periodical Devoted to Odd Fellowship and General Literature.

Letter from George F. Koon to Mr. Otterson, 1878 August 8
This letter from George F. Koon of the Masonic Historical Society of Vermont requests information regarding the names of Vermont's original Masons and when and where they were made. Written while at North Bennington, Vermont, and dated August 8, 1878.

Unsigned letter from Royal Woodward to his brother, circa 1828
An unsigned and undated letter attributed to Royal Woodward of Ashford, Connecticut. In this letter to his brother, Woodward discusses the health and well-being of his family and friends and gives his opinions on Freemasonry.
Masonic dues cards issued to Ludwig Froberg, 1923-1933
Collection of 41 Masonic dues cards issued to Ludwig Froberg includes Order of Eastern Star, Metropolitan Lodge, No. 273, in NYC, and Royal Arch Masons Ancient Chapter, No. 1, in NYC.
Reprint of advertisement for Robert Brookhouse, Goldsmith & Jeweler, circa 1934
Reprint of a circa 1789 engraving in the form of an advertisement for Robert Brookhouse, goldsmith & jeweller, on Essex Street, between Court & North Streets, in Salem, MA. Various Masonic symbols are on the card include the square and compass, the beehive, and the coffin.
Photograph and autograph of C. S. Wilson, District Grand Master of Egypt and the Sudan, circa 1900
Photograph and autograph of C.S. Wilson, Brigadier General and District Grand Master of Egypt and the Sudan. Image of Mason sitting in full regalia including apron, sash, jewels, and cuffs.
